The diversity score of Success Academy Charter School-bronx 5 Upper is 0.53,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.72.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
How many students attend Success Academy Charter School-bronx 5 Upper?
97 students attend Success Academy Charter School-bronx 5 Upper.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
57% of Success Academy Charter School-bronx 5 Upper students are Hispanic, 38% of students are Black, 4% of students are Two or more races, and 1% of students are American Indian.
What grades does Success Academy Charter School-bronx 5 Upper offer ?
Success Academy Charter School-bronx 5 Upper offers enrollment in grades 2-4
